Once, in a post office in some town in Massachusetts, I watched as an elderly gent bought 1,000 Forever stamps, the nondenominational ones that you can use, well, forever. I thought it was nuts. But that was back in 2007 when they were first introduced, at the price of 41 cents. Today the same first class stamp costs 46 cents, as of later this month. So, is it worth it to stockpile Forever stamps? Personally, I don't think so, unless you have cash coming out of your ears -- except it's convenient, and one less thing to worry about.
